Danielle Pheloung helped push dot cakes from The Dotcakes in Roslyn, New York, into TikTok’s latest food fixation, and her taste-test clip has now drawn over 7 million views. The sprinkle-topped mini cake cups are selling in four variations, but the surge has already forced the bakery to pause order requests.

Pheloung described the dessert in terms that made the format easy to copy and easy to argue about: “It tastes like a funfetti cake with a lot of crunch.” She also said, “It’s really, really, really, really, really good,” and called it “the best thing” she had ever had in her entire life.

Kennedy Clark offered a similar read on the texture, writing, “The cake is super light and fluffy, and then the frosting on top is really good” and “The sprinkles on top add a little crunch.” Those comments gave the trend a clear product pitch, which is exactly why food creators started DIY-ing the dessert after it spread.

The Dotcakes Pause

The Dotcakes offers dot cakes in white, chocolate, vanilla chip, and red velvet, each with a thick layer of sprinkle-coated frosting on top. That mix turned a local bakery item into a social-media commodity fast enough that other bakeries quickly jumped aboard, while some users pushed back by saying it is just cake with sprinkles.

The bakery’s pause on order requests is the clearest sign that this is more than a passing post. A user comment summed up the demand side in three words — “I NEED IT RN” — and the line fits the problem for anyone trying to buy them now.

Roslyn To New York City

Dot Cakes are available at Butterfield Market in New York City on Wednesdays at 11 a.m. and Saturdays at 1 p.m., and at the OG Dotcakes bakery in Roslyn from Tuesday to Friday at 10 a.m. and 2 p.m. and on Saturday at 10 a.m. For customers, that means the product has moved beyond a single bakery counter and into two separate pickup windows.
